What is Ferrous Sulfate 50?
Ferrous sulfate 50 is a chemical compound with the formula FeSO4. It typically contains a significant percentage of iron, making it an essential source of this vital mineral. The “50” often refers to its concentration or purity level, indicating that it contains 50% ferrous iron. This compound is available in various forms, including heptahydrate (FeSO4·7H2O), which is the most common form used in various applications.
Benefits of Ferrous Sulfate 50
1. Nutritional Supplement: Ferrous sulfate is widely used as a dietary supplement to treat and prevent iron deficiency anemia. It provides a readily absorbable form of iron, which is crucial for the production of hemoglobin and overall energy levels.
2. Soil Amendment: In agriculture, ferrous sulfate 50 is used to improve soil quality. It helps in correcting iron chlorosis in plants, which occurs when there is insufficient available iron in the soil. By adding ferrous sulfate, farmers can enhance plant health, promote growth, and increase crop yields.
3. Water Treatment: Ferrous sulfate is an effective coagulant in water treatment processes. It helps remove impurities and suspended particles from water, making it cleaner and safer for consumption. This property is particularly valuable in municipal water treatment facilities.
4. Industrial Applications: In various industries, ferrous sulfate 50 is used in the production of pigments, as a reducing agent, and in the manufacturing of other iron compounds. Its versatility makes it an integral part of numerous industrial processes.
Uses of Ferrous Sulfate 50
1. Agricultural Use
Ferrous sulfate 50 is primarily used in agriculture to address iron deficiency in plants. It can be applied directly to the soil or as a foliar spray, ensuring that plants receive the necessary nutrients for healthy growth. It is particularly beneficial for crops such as citrus, roses, and other acid-loving plants.
2. Medical Use
In the medical field, ferrous sulfate is commonly prescribed to individuals suffering from iron deficiency anemia. It is available in various forms, including tablets and liquid solutions, making it convenient for patients to incorporate into their daily routines. Regular intake can significantly improve iron levels and overall health.
3. Water Treatment
In water treatment, ferrous sulfate 50 plays a crucial role in coagulation and flocculation processes. It helps to remove contaminants and improve water clarity, making it essential for municipal and industrial water treatment facilities.
4. Construction and Manufacturing
Ferrous sulfate 50 is also used in construction for producing concrete and in various manufacturing processes. It is utilized in the production of ferric sulfate, which is an important chemical in water treatment and other applications.
